Transaction 886644dcd61b60eb228a79b1003e06d695599416059802dfd4283b46030f5c24
1 Input
1 Output
-
886644dcd61b60eb228a79b1003e06d695599416059802dfd4283b46030f5c24:0
- value
- 90410
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 06175903c8c3d1dcf678f4fb7226d3ce9fae9d54 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ZD2NxaWfPwAgVD9SEcj7VPCSVMZVEv19